重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1.预先准备在你开始将程序提交到App Store之前,你需要有一个App ID,一个有效的发布证书,以及一个有效的Provisioning profile。下面来看看它们各自的作用。Step 1: App ID(应用ID)App ID是识别不同应用程序的唯一标示符。每个app都需要一个App ID或者app标识。目前有两种类型的App标识:一个是精确的App ID( explicit App ID),一个是通配符App ID( wildcard App ID)。使用通配符的App ID可以用来构建和安装多个程序。尽管通配符App ID非常方便,但是一个精确的App ID也是需要的,尤其是当App使用iCloud 或者使用其他iOS功能的时候,比如Game Center、Push Notifications或者IAP。 如果你不确定什么样的App ID适合你的项目,我推荐你读下苹果关于这一主题的文档: Technical Note QA1713。 Step 2: Distribution Certificate(发布证书) iOS应用都有一个安全证书用于验证开发者身份和签名。为了可以向App Store提交app,你需要创建一个iOS provisioning profile 。首先需要创建一个distribution certificate(发布证书),过程类似于创建一个development certificate(开发证书)。如果你已经在实体设备上测试你的App,那么你对创建development certificate就已经很熟悉了。 如果对此不熟悉,我建议你读下 苹果关于signing certificates和provisioning profiles的详细指导 。 Step 3: Provisioning Profile(配置文件) 一旦你创建了App ID和distribution certificate,你可以创建一个iOS provisioning profile以方便在App Store中销售你的App。不过,你不能使用和ad hoc distribution相同的provisioning profile。你需要为App Store分销创建一个单独的provisioning profile,如果你使用通配符App ID,那么你的多个app就可以使用相同的provisioning profile。 Step 4: Build Settings(生成设置)配置App ID、distribution certificate 和provisioning profile已经完成,是时候配置Xcode中target的build settings了。在Xcode Project Navigator的targets列表中选择一个target,打开顶部的 Build Settings选项,然后更新一下 Code Signing来跟之前创建的distribution provisioning profile相匹配。最近添加的provisioning profiles有时候不会立马就在build settings的 Code Signing中看到,重启一下Xcode就可以解决这个问题。 配置Target的Build SettingsStep 5: Deployment Target(部署目标)非常有必要说下deployment target,Xcode中每个target都有一个deployment target,它可以指出app可以运行的最小版本。不过,一旦应用在App Store中生效,再去修改deployment target,你要考虑到一定后果。如果你在更新app的时候提高了deployment target,但是已经购买应用的用户并没有遇到新的deployment target,那么应用就不能在用户的移动设备上运行。如果用户通过iTunes (不是设备)下载了一个更新过的app,然后替代了设备上原先的版本,最后却发现新版本不能在设备上运行,这确实是个问题。(1) 当你决定提高现有app的deployment target时,要在新版本的版本注释中进行说明。如果你提前告知用户,那么至少有一点,你已经尽力阻止问题的发生了。(2) 对于一款新app,我经常会把deployment target设置为最近发布的系统版 本。因为新iOS版本发布后,渗透率的增长速度是令人难以置信的。很多人认为提高deployment target会失去大部分市场,这个说法并不准确,比如iOS 6, iOS 6发布后一个月,超过60%的设备已经进行了更新 。但对Android而言,就是另外一回事了, Android用户并不会像iOS用户那样热衷于更新操作系统版本 。 【以上简而言之,最好从项目设计时,就决定是否考虑兼容低版本用户,支持的话,写代码时使用ios新特性时最好做一下判断,if是老版本if是新版本】在最新的WWDC2014上,公布的数字显示,iOS7的市场占有率已经为87%2. Assets(资源包)Step 1: Icons(图标)Icon是App中不可分割的一部分,你要确保icon尺寸不会出现差错。iTunes Artwork: 1024px x 1024px (required)iPad/iPad Mini: 72px x 72px and 114px x 114px (required) iPhone/iPod Touch: 57px x 57px and 114px x 114px (required) 120px x 120px(required) for iPhone5/iPhone5c/iPhone5sSearch Icon: 29px x 29px and 58px x 58px (optional) Settings Application: 50px x 50px and 100px x 100px (optional) Step 2: 屏幕截图屏幕截图的作用不言而喻,你可以为每个app上传5张截图,虽然至少需要上传一张,可能很少有人会只上传一张图片。另外,你还需要分别为 iPhone/iPod Touch和iPad/iPad Mini准备不同的屏幕截图。这也是不小的工作量,但却能展示应用的另一面。Shiny Development开发的一款售价6.99美元的Mac软件 Status Magic可以为你节省不少时间。Status Magic可以帮你把状态栏放在截图的正确位置。 屏幕截图和icon是应用给用户的第一感觉,直接关系到用户会不会购买。不过,你所上传的屏幕截图也不一定非得是实际的截图,看看 Where’s My Water? 截图可以通过使用此策略,更具吸引力和说服力。当我们连上调试机以后。可以利用Xcode中Organizer中的New Screenshot轻松的截出标准大小的图片。Step 3: 元数据 在提交应用之前,要管理好app的元数据,包括1应用名称、2版本号、3主要类别,4简洁的描述,5关键词,6.支持URL。如果你需要更新应用,你还要提供新增加的版本内容。 如果你的应用需要注册【打开APP需要登录,比如飞信】,你还得向苹果提供一个测试账户或者demo账户,这样审核人员就能很快进入app,而不用再注册账号。3. 提交准备Xcode 4以后,开发者提交应用的过程就简单多了,可以直接使用Xcode进行提交。首先在 iTunes Connect中创建app,访问iTunes Connect,使用你的iOS开发者账号登陆,点击右边的“Manage Your Apps”,点击左上角的“Add New App”,选择“iOS App”,然后完成表格。
创新互联公司长期为上千客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为任城企业提供专业的做网站、成都网站制作,任城网站改版等技术服务。拥有十载丰富建站经验和众多成功案例,为您定制开发。
方法如下:
1、在桌面找到设置。
2、进入苹果手机的设置界面。
3、在设置界面,找到通用,进入通用界面。
4、将通过界面拉到底部,要么会出现信任文件,要么就是设备管理。
5、点击设备管理,可以看到企业级应用。
6、点击企业级应用“Beijing DongFen Technology”,就可以看到信任此应用,点击删除即可。
拓展资料:
iPhone,是苹果公司旗下研发的智能手机系列,它搭载苹果公司研发的iOS手机作业系统。第一代iPhone于2007年1月9日由当时苹果公司CEO的史蒂夫·乔布斯发布,并在同年6月29日正式发售。
第七代的iPhone 5S和iPhone 5C于2013年9月10日发布,同年9月20日正式发售。第八代的iPhone 6和iPhone6 Plus于2014年9月10日发布。2015年9月10日凌晨1点,苹果将召开2015年秋季发布会,发布三款不同型号的新iPhone,分别是iPhone 6S、iPhone 6S Plus。
2016年3月21日凌晨1点,苹果召开了2016年春季发布会,发布了iPhone SE,而不是网上说的iPhone 6C。
iPhone 7于北京时间2016年9月8日凌晨1点在美国旧金山比尔·格雷厄姆市政礼堂2016年苹果秋季新品发布会上发布。
2016年11月25日,苹果在官网更新了iPhone在国内的保修政策,不再以换代修。
2017年3月21日,苹果推出了一款拥有动人红色外观的特别版iPhone 7和iPhone 7 Plus,起售价格为6188元。
2017年9月13日,苹果推出了新一代产品iPhone 8和iPhone 8 Plus、iPhone X
不要乱安装,要看好描述文件获取的权限,看好权限再去安装一般没有问题!
这个文件是开发者签证的文件。比如说,开发了一个苹果应用程序,那么,要通过这个文件验证之后,才能安装在 iPhone 手机上。技术开发者,对这个文件再陌生不过了。
步骤如下:
(1)在主屏幕上找到“设置”图标并打开它。
(2)在设置的列表下,轻按选择“通用”按钮。
(3)然后,向上拖曳屏幕,以显示到屏幕的底部。轻按“描述文件”按钮。
(4)接着,就就可以查看到“描述文件”的信息。
其实,iPhone 里边的描述文件,有没有关系不大。而且,这个文件可以在 MAC 上,需要时进行安装。如果说没有这个文件,则无法将开发者应用程序,安装到 iPhone 手机上。一般用户,可以不用理会这个描述文件。
当您在 iOS 12.2 或更高版本或 iPadOS 中从网站或电子邮件中下载配置描述文件(包括用于注册移动设备管理的描述文件)后,您需要前往“设置” App 进行安装。
1.打开“设置”App。
2.轻点“已下载描述文件”或“注册 [组织的名称]”。

3.轻点右上角的“安装”,然后按照屏幕上的说明操作。
您一次只能安装一个描述文件。例如,如果您下载了一个描述文件但没有进行安装,然后又下载了第二个描述文件,则只能安装第二个描述文件。如果在下载后的 8 分钟内没有安装描述文件,则这个描述文件会被自动删除。